Macpac – company profile

walking up Mt Stirling, VIC

From reading their materials, it seems that Macpac has an environmental principle based on the old ‘3 R’s’: reduce, reuse, recycle. They state that they attempt to make good technical gear that is designed and built to last a long time: in effect, making gear of substance that will last, rather than short lived outdoor fashion items that will need to be replaced in a few years. I have always been impressed at how durable their equipment is, and so had been hopeful that this company would be a leading light in terms of sustainability.

However, with the information that’s publically available it is hard to even rate them at this point.
